Description

A rippling brook meanders alongside the moss-covered stone wall, under the arched stone bridges, and through the tranquil garden of this adorable stone cottage in the picturesque village of Combs in the High Peak. Located close to the Combs Reservoir, with its rich bird life and many wandering footpaths, this historic village is conveniently located on the route between Chapel-en-le-Frith and Whaley Bridge, offering a gateway to the Peak District and all the attractions this national treasure has to offer. Although easily accessible via the A6, the village is neatly tucked between rolling hills, offering beautiful farmland views and a peaceful county lifestyle.

Millway is a three-bedroom detached home with just under half an acre of land. The home is built of Derbyshire stone and is believed to date back to the 16th century. The depth of the window ledges illustrates the solidness of the original construction, and the beautiful, exposed beams throughout the home represent the charm and character of the era. Incorporating many traditional features such as an ancient lead pane window thought to date back to the 1500s and an antique stove in a stone hearth, the home perfectly balances the old and the new, providing a family home ideally suited to modern living!

The large, bright kitchen has been fitted with new cabinetry and beautiful faux wooden tops and features down-lighting, offering a modern and functional room with enough space for a breakfast table. The spacious room comfortably incorporates an original Aga that warms the room during winter. A large double sink sits in front of a picture window, looking out on the terraced garden, allowing the morning sun to stream into the room. A large utility room adjacent to the kitchen provides ample space for appliances and storage and has a back door to the terrace. Also leading from the kitchen is a spacious dining room with a fireplace set in a stone feature wall framed by characteristic wooden beams. The current playroom located off the dining room offers a versatile space, while a separate study provides a work-from-home option. Both rooms could be repurposed to suit any requirement.

The living room has newly plastered walls, a fireplace incorporating a practical log burner, and flagstone flooring. It is dual-aspect with windows allowing the sun in throughout the day and double cottage-paned French doors open onto the terrace.

The generous hallway is an ideal second sitting room featuring a striking cast-iron stove. It provides access to the guest WC, an under-stair cupboard, and a broad staircase leading to the first floor.

Upstairs are three generous bedrooms and an exceptionally large family bathroom. The main bedroom includes an en-suite bathroom and a charming dressing room with a walk-in wardrobe. All bedrooms have feature beams and large windows offering views of the beautiful gardens and surrounding hills. The main bedroom also has a granite-framed fireplace and an open outside balcony, providing a private retreat to enjoy the unspoilt landscape.

Outside, the terrace is ideal for al fresco dining and incorporates a millstone table as a feature. There is a large log store and a double garage. With the very popular Beehive Inn a short walk away, this home is ideally located in the village and ticks all the boxes!
